Submitting 2 Limit Orders at Once
I'd like to be able to set two pending limit orders, one buy one sell, where upon the triggering of one (both have the same ATM strategy), if cancels the other. I keep getting an error that says I can't submit an exit order to a strategy until any of its entry orders has been filled.
Any way to do this? I tried looking at a Ninja Strategy but didn't see any way to do it. If there's a basic template out there anyone is aware of a link would be much appreciated (if I can't do it without have to create)Tags: None
-
Hello,
If using an ATM you'll need to reselect a new instance of the ATM strategy, which you can do automatically if you change the ATM strategy selection mode. To do this, right click on the chart trader interface or Superdom you are using and select 'properties', then change the ATM strategy selection mode option to 'keep selected ATM strategy template on order submission'.Ryan S.NinjaTrader Customer Service
